February 24, 2023 N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 23V127000
Incorrect Gross Axle Weight Rating/FMVSS 120 & 567
An overloaded vehicle can increase the risk of a crash.
NHTSA Campaign Number: 23V127
Manufacturer Xos, Inc.
Components EQUIPMENT
Potential Number of Units Affected 259
Summary
Xos, Inc. (Xos) is recalling certain 2021-2022 SV05 Stepvan vehicles. The tire and loading information label has an incorrect front gross axle weight rating, which could lead to an unintentional overloading of the vehicle.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ard numbers 120, “Wheels and Rims-Other than Passenger Car,” and 49 CFR Part 567, “Certification.”
Remedy
Xos will mail replacement labels to owners,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 6, 2023. Owners may contact Xos customer service at 1-818-316-1890. Xos’s number for this recall is REC 001-23.
Notes
Owners may also contact the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ration Vehicle Safety Hotline at 1-888-327-4236 (TTY 1-800-424-9153), or go to www.nhtsa.gov.
Chronology :
On or around January 15, 2023, an Xos engineer identified a discrepancy between the front gross axle weight rating shown on the SV05 Part 567 Compliance Label and the rating of the front tires. The front gross axle weight rating on the SV05 Part 567 Compliance Label was listed as 10,000 lbs. The weight rating for the front tires is 4,940 lbs. each. The issue was reported to Xos’s engineering team and an evaluation of the issue was commenced.
On February 17, 2023, the topic was presented to Xos’s Product Safety Committee. Based upon the information presented, the Product Safety Committee decided to initiate a recall to address this condition.
To date, there have been no warranty claims and no reports of accidents or injuries related to this condition.

Description of the Noncompliance :
Xos has determined that in certain Xos Stepvans the front gross axle weight rating may exceed the sum of the maximum load ratings of the front tires. This constitutes a noncompliance with FMVSS 120, S5.1.2, which specifies, in part, that “the sum of the maximum load ratings of the tires fitted to an axle shall be not less than the gross axle weight rating (GAWR) of the axle system as specified on the vehicle’s certification label required by 49 CFR part 567.” FMVSS 1 : 120 – Wheels and rims- other than passenger cars FMVSS 2 : 567 – Certification
Description of the Safety Risk : Overloading over time could cause excessive tire wear and in a worst case
scenario, could lead to tire failure, increasing the risk of a crash.
Description of the Cause : The gross axle weight rating of the front axle was misidentified due to an oversight in the engineering process. Identification of Any Warning

On or around January 15, 2023, an Xos engineer identified a discrepancy between the front gross axle weight rating shown on the SV05 Part 567 Compliance Label and the rating of the front tires. The front gross axle weight rating on the SV05 Part 567 Compliance Label was listed as 10,000 lbs. The weight rating for the front tires is 4,940 lbs. each. The issue was reported to Xos’s engineering team and an evaluation of the issue was commenced. On February 17, 2023, the topic was presented to Xos’s Product Safety Committee. Based upon the information presented, the Product Safety Committee decided to initiate a recall to address this condition. To date, there have been no warranty claims and no reports of accidents or injuries related to this condition. Description of Remedy :
Description of Remedy Program : Xos will send replacement Part 567 Compliance Labels listing the correct
gross axle weight rating to impacted customers. How Remedy Component Differs from Recalled Component :
Identify How/When Recall Condition was Corrected in Production : Remedy labels list the correct front gross axle weight rating. The maximum front gross axle weight rating was changed to 9,000 lbs. in production vehicles shipped after 2/13/2023. From this date, the requirements of FMVSS 120, S5.1.2 are fulfilled on production vehicles The information contained in this report was submitted pursuant to 49 CFR §573 Part 573 Safety Recall Report 23V-127
